A uniform magnetic field passes through a horizontal circular wire loop at an angle 17.3° from the normal to the plane of the loop. The magnitude of the magnetic field is 3.95 T, and the radius of the wire loop is 0.250 m. Find the magnetic flux through the loop. Wb
